The application veohwebplayer138setup_eng.exe by Qlipso has been detected as a potentially unwanted program by 9 anti-malware scanners. The program is a setup application that uses the NSIS (Nullsoft Scriptable Install System) installer. The file has been seen being downloaded from ll-appserver.veoh.com and multiple other hosts.

Explanation:
Packages the OpenCandy software bundler that offers to install additional software and may include web browser add-ons and toolbars which display advertising (based on publisher settings and geo context).
